Steps to make WorkShop Chocolate hummus with strawberry flavoured toast:
  1. For roasted Walnut and Sesame Seeds
  2. Heat 1 TSP sesame oil in a pan. - add the walnut and Sesame, use a spatula to stir the both until they are nicely brown and deeply toasted flavour. - it takes approx 5 minutes, now transfer to a tray. use when it cool down.
  3. For chocolate hummus
  4. Take a grinder jar, put all the chocolate hummus ingredients in it and mix like a fine paste
  5. It's ready.keep in a refrigerator.
  6. For strawberry sauce
  7. Heat the pan, add chopped strawberries, sugar, lemon juice and salt in it and after 8 to 10 minutes. It will be ready.
  8. Use when it cool down.
  9. How to preparing
  10. Dip toast in a milkmaid for 10 to 20 seconds
  11. Now keep it on the serving plate, apply some chocolate hummus on it,
  12. Sprinkle some chopped almonds - now apply 1 teaspoon strawberry sauce and then top with the other piece of toast.
  13. Now put 1/2 teaspoon strawberry sauce on top. - And Serve with 1 chocolate hummus.
